Abstract

The utility model discloses a negative ion silica -gel hot -water bottle, including the inner bag, set up in the inner bag heat -retaining liquid and electrical bar and with the power that the electrical bar is connected through the insulated wire electricity is participated in, the surface of inner bag sets up the negative ion silica -gel layer, the negative ion silica -gel layer with the surface of inner bag contacts, the negative ion silica -gel layer includes the colloidal silica for releasing micro molecule anion and far infrared. The utility model provides a negative ion silica -gel hot -water bottle has improved the health care and the physiotherapy effect of hot -water bottle, can be used for sick hot compress such as cervical spondylopathy, periomethritis, arthritis, effectively alleviates treatment painful and supplementary disease.

Background technology
Traditional hot water bag is the empty sack that a rubber is made, and one is provided with thermal output entrance, with stopper sealing, needs when in use to inject hot water, needs constantly more heat-exchanging water in continuous print use procedure.Present this conventional hot water's bag gradually by the electric hot-water bag of storage water heater and electric baking pan replace.The electric hot-water bag of storage water heater, by loading liquid, the inside arranges an electric heater, the liquid plugged in heating bag, thus reaches the object of heating electric hot-water bag; Electric baking pan, its filling is heat-preservation cotton, and plug in the moisturizing cotton heating that can make the inside, reaches the effect of heating electric baking pan.
Although existing hot water bag is of a great variety, it is all be traditional heating and insulation that function uses, and carries out warming oneself, hot compress or massage.Hot compress or massage use hot water bag mainly in order to improve temperature, impel the vasodilation of contact position, accelerate blood circulation, fatigue alleviating or slight illness.But be only fixed against the heating temperatures also not enough needs meeting people's health care or physical therapy of hot water bag.
Visible, how to provide a kind of hot water bag, improving health care or the physiotheraping effect of hot water bag, is those skilled in the art's problem demanding prompt solutions.

Embodiment one
With reference to attached Fig. 1 and 2, attached Fig. 1 and 2 goes out the basic structure of the negative ion silica-gel hot water bag that this utility model embodiment provides from overall and cross-sectional internal configuration shows.The negative ion silica-gel hot water bag that this utility model embodiment provides comprises inner bag 1, power pin 5 (the inner bag 1 being arranged on the heat accumulation liquid 3 of inner bag 1 li and electrical bar 4 and being electrically connected by insulated conductor with electrical bar 4, heat accumulation liquid 3 and electrical bar 4, power pin 5 can entirety be called hot water bag body), and the negative ion silica-gel layer being attached to inner bag 1 outer surface is negative ion silica-gel sheet 2, negative ion silica-gel sheet 2 is the colloidal silica that can discharge micromolecule anion and far infrared, by silica gel main material, tourmaline powder, anion powder, far-infrared powder, carry silver-colored titanium dioxide, zeolite with carrying silver, the composition such as silver-loaded zirconium phosphate and Maifanitum is formed.
Wherein: inner bag 1 is air-locked soft polymer material, there is certain intensity, ensure the use of hot water bag after can ensureing to have filled heat accumulation liquid 3, the sack that rubber, resin or other waterproof materials are made can be selected, the shape of sack does not do concrete restriction, can arrange voluntarily as required.Heat accumulation liquid 3 is a kind of liquid that can utilize Resistant heating, or can conduct electricity the hot water bag of heat-storage medium by means of heated by electrodes, and electrical bar 4 and heat accumulation liquid 3 match, as electrode, and electrical heating heat accumulation liquid 3.The body of hot water bag is similar to existing hot water bag simultaneously, so also can select other structures.
The negative ion silica-gel hot water bag that this utility model embodiment provides, the negative ion silica-gel sheet 2 of the outer surface attachment of inner bag 1, silica gel piece 2 is attached to a part for inner bag 1, because consider that described negative ion silica-gel hot water bag is for external application, the one side of hot water bag is only had to press close to the human body of wanted hot compress in the process that external application uses, save cost, avoid unnecessary waste.In fact be not limited to negative ion silica-gel sheet 2 structure and can also make graininess attaching and inner bag 1 outer surface.
Consider the safety of the negative ion silica-gel hot water bag that this utility model provides, the inner bag 1 of described negative ion silica-gel hot water bag arranges safe explosion-proof device 6.Often occur that hot water bag is waited in use now to blast, occur that the main cause of blast is that hot water bag internal gas pressure is excessive, cause hot water bag to carry and explosion occurs.Anti-explosion safety device 6 can be a relief valve, this relief valve can be a pressure-regulating valve, when in hot water bag, pressure meets or exceeds certain pressure time, in the automatic release bag of pressure valve, gas is to regulate pressure in hot water bag, avoids because the excessive generation occurring explosive injury people thing of pressure in hot water bag.Also can select other safe explosion-proof devices, as long as can assist explosion-proof just passable simultaneously.
The negative ion silica-gel hot water bag that this utility model provides, charged by the external power pin 5 that switches on power, heat accumulation liquid 3 is heated by electrically heated rod, inner bag 1 entirety heats up, reach the effect of different hot water bag, can carry out warming oneself, the outer surface of hot compress or massage inner bag 1 simultaneously because arrange negative ion silica-gel layer, can discharge micromolecule anion and far infrared, the temperature after the heating of hot water bag simultaneously more can excite the activity of negative ion silica-gel layer.Negative ion silica-gel hot water bag is when the effect meeting the heating of original hot water bag, hot compress or massage, effect due to negative ion silica-gel body can also be used for hot compress or massage raising purifies the blood, accelerates blood circulation and metabolic effect, simultaneously for the effect that the hot compress etc. that cervical spondylosis, scapulohumeral periarthritis, arthritis etc. are sick also has alleviating pain, scattered siltization stagnant, improve health care and the physiotheraping effect of hot water bag.

Embodiment three
See accompanying drawing 5, fig. 5 illustrate the basic structure of the negative ion silica-gel hot water bag that this utility model embodiment provides, compared to embodiment one and two, the structure of the inner bag 1 of negative ion silica-gel hot water bag, heat accumulation liquid 3, electrical bar 4, power pin 5 safe explosion-proof device 6 is identical, do not repeat them here, different places is also to comprise outer bag 9 in the present embodiment, described outer bag 9 is set in outside inner bag 1, outer bag 9 and inner bag 1 form interlayer, colloidal silica is filled in described interlayer, and outer bag 9 and the described negative ion silica-gel body be filled in interlayer form negative ion silica-gel layer.
For being uniformly distributed of negative ion silica-gel body in the interlayer between guarantee outer bag 9 and inner bag 1, dowel 8 is set in described interlayer, dowel 8 is evenly distributed in described interlayer, and one end of each root dowel 8 connects outer bag 9 inner surface, and the other end connects inner bag 1 outer surface.Adjacent dowel 8 forms lattice room, and each lattice room is used for holding negative ion silica-gel body.For ensureing distributing more uniformly of negative ion silica-gel body, dowel 8 is evenly distributed on described outer bag 9 and is formed in interlayer with inner bag 1.Negative ion silica-gel body is the negative ion silica-gel body bulk cargo 10 of one or more compositions of negative ion silica-gel fiber, negative ion silica-gel granule, negative ion silica-gel powder and negative ion silica-gel slip, surface area like this is large, increase the release of micromolecule anion and far infrared, improve health care and the physiotheraping effect of negative ion silica-gel hot water bag.Negative ion silica-gel body bulk cargo 10 can be that the waste product, waste material, tailing etc. of negative ion silica-gel product processes, with low cost, saving resource.
